‘Jagga Jasoos’ could have been shelved?

Anurag Basu’s ambitious project ‘Jagga Jasoos’ has been through a lot more than a few miss-haps during it’s making. With the main delay being due to leads Ranbir Kapoor and Katrina Kaif having ended their relationship and it putting a strain on shooting, apparently there was a point where the team were thinking of scrapping the film altogether.

Kapoor, who is also co-producing the project, told Mid-Day, “We [Ranbir, Anurag and Katrina] would often discuss the progress of the film. Often, we would wonder if we should shelve it. But then, in the end, I’d go back to the time I first heard the story, when it made me feel amazing. And that took us through the journey. When I saw the film, I realised that it turned out exactly like my director had envisioned it, like he had narrated it four years ago. It felt really good.”

Becoming attached to the film’s story from the word go, it seems like Kapoor’s investment in the project worked in their favour. Despite the film taking a long time, Kapoor believes it was all worth it. “There are some films which take time to make. I have shot for ‘Jagga Jasoos’ for 150 days. But, in the past, I have shot for other films for as long. This film only took longer to come together. We had to battle the negative reports surrounding the film. I would be lying if I said that it didn’t bother me. In the end, we decided to concentrate on the positives and move ahead,” he explained.

Kapoor will be seen in yet another unconventional role as he platys a teenager how has a stammer. Despite his experience with similar roles, this character did come with it’s challenges, as he explained, “The challenge was to get the stammering right. It can look fake and sound jarring. But, I went with the flow.”
